Holiday Luncheon Empowers Women Entrepreneurs

 

“Give Girls a Chance, Empower Women and Unleash Their Potential” was the theme of Pratham Houston’s annual holiday fashion show and luncheon on December 4, 2015. The event, held at the Junior League of Houston, brought together 300 of the city’s fashionable philanthropists and raised over $170,000 for Pratham’s Beauty Entrepreneurship Program.

Launched in 2011, the program provides training, mentorship and financial support to female entrepreneurs across India. Your generosity during last year’s holiday luncheon allowed Pratham to expand the Beauty Entrepreneurship Program with three new training centers. From January through June, we trained 375 students and supported 51 entrepreneurs in starting their own salons or providing door-to-door home services.

This year’s luncheon featured a fashion show of original evening wear by Sameera Faridi of Poshak Fashion & Style, as well as men’s fashions by Hector Villarreal of Lucho Men’s Clothier. Models were from Houston’s Neal Hamill Agency.

Keynote speaker Dr. Sandeep Shah shared his recent ultra-marathon experience, likening the grueling 101-mile run to the challenges faced by underprivileged kids in India hoping to acquire a quality education. “Pratham has all the tools, and now you need to make the effort to help it,” he concluded. Guests responded to both Sandeep’s and outgoing chapter president Dr. Marie Goradia’s appeals by filling in pledge cards and easily surpassing the pledge drive’s $20,000 goal.
